Create a budget for Your Remodeling Project - A guide

Budgeting for a renovation undertaking requires meticulous preparation and evaluation. First, one must determine the project scope to understand the amount of labor required. Next, researching material costs and incorporating a emergency budget can help manage unforeseen costs effectively.

Define Your Project Scope

A well-defined project scope is crucial for any remodeling project, as it sets the stage for an effective budget. Initially, homeowners should specify particular goals and desired results, recognizing which areas need renovation. This involves clarifying the scope of work required, whether that be a full remodel or minor updates. Following this, sorting tasks assists in focusing efforts effectively, leading to a more methodical approach. Homeowners ought to account for timelines, since project length can significantly affect costs. Moreover, consulting experts early on offers helpful guidance and realistic expectations. By defining with clarity the project scope, individuals can allocate funds properly, limiting unexpected charges and ensuring a successful renovation experience.

Assess Material Financial Outlays

Investigating material expenses represents an vital aspect of the renovation process, since it significantly affects the total budget. Homeowners must start by pinpointing the particular materials required for their project, which may include floor coverings, cabinet work, and fixtures. Online resources, local suppliers, and home improvement stores can deliver valuable pricing information. It's vital to compare various brands and quality levels, as prices can differ significantly. Furthermore, exploring bulk purchasing options or discounts can lead to significant savings. Property owners must also account for any additional expenses, such as delivery fees or installation costs, to ensure an precise financial plan. Through careful comprehension material expenses, people can make informed decisions that match their financial constraints and project goals.

A reserve fund is a vital element of any renovation undertaking budget. This fund functions as a monetary cushion to handle unexpected costs that may occur throughout the remodeling timeline. Industry professionals advise setting aside 10% to 20% of the overall project cost for this purpose. Issues such as concealed structural issues, changes in material prices, or design alterations can result in additional costs. By preparing for these possible scenarios, property owners can avoid financial hardship and keep momentum going. Furthermore, a well-planned contingency fund can create peace of mind, allowing homeowners to concentrate on the transformation of their space rather than the unpredictability of budgeting. Ultimately, a contingency fund is essential for successful and stress-free remodeling.

Frequent Mistakes to Steer Clear Of During Home Upgrades

Home renovations can significantly improve a property's worth, but they often involve challenges that can compromise the planned improvements. One frequent mistake is failing to establish a practical spending plan, which can result in excessive spending and monetary stress. Property owners often miscalculate completion schedules, causing extended interruptions to daily life. Another common error is neglecting to investigate licensing requirements and codes, which can delay work and accumulate fines.

Also, many underestimate the necessity of hiring qualified professionals. Going with amateur service providers may lead to mediocre quality of work and high-priced repairs down the line. Homeowners often prioritize aesthetics over functionality, losing sight of the fact that a well-designed space should balance both. Finally, neglecting to speak effectively with contractors can create conflicts and unmet objectives. By circumventing these common mistakes, homeowners can promise smoother renovations that truly better their dwellings.

Frequently Asked Questions

How much time Does a Typical Remodeling Project Take?

A common renovation job usually needs ranging from a few weeks to several months, contingent on the scope of work, difficulty of the plan, and availability of materials and labor, impacting overall timelines markedly.

Which Permits Are Required for Home Renovation Work?

Home renovations typically need building permits, electrical permits, plumbing permits, and sometimes zoning approvals. The specific requirements differ depending on location, requiring homeowners to review local regulations to guarantee compliance before starting any renovation projects.

Is It Acceptable to Live in My Home While Remodeling?

Yes, one can reside in their home during remodeling, but it may lead to challenges. Consider factors like noise, airborne particles, and limited entry to certain areas, which can disrupt daily routines and overall comfort during construction.

What Forms of Protections Do Remodeling Services Give?

Remodeling services typically provide warranties that include craftsmanship, products, and particular timeframes, often ranging from one to ten years. These guarantees ensure quality control and safeguard against defects, providing homeowners with confidence after renovations.
